SYMPTOMS
Consider the following scenario in Microsoft SQL Server 2005 Analysis Services. You use the Multidimensional Expressions (MDX) Crossjoin function in a named set to return the cross product of two sets from the same dimension. If there is more than one dimension is involved in this expression, you may receive unexpected results when you query data from the cube.

Registry information
You do not have to restart the computer after you apply this hotfix. However, the hotfix stops and then restarts the Analysis Services service. If you configured the server for HTTP access, you must stop Microsoft Internet Information Services (IIS) and then restart IIS after you apply this hotfix. If you installed Analysis Services as a named instance, you must stop the SQL Server Browser service. You must do this because the Msmdredir.dll component of the SQL Server Browser service is updated when you apply this hotfix.
